Output 81868f2240a4137d6ca022bda03f1107119a48655fb75c59c68756b087aa0a44:1

value
2000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58a7733141ad738e180c575ae7cb24466fc5eb6f OP_EQUALVERIFY OP_CHECKSIG
address
195m4WXE8ZeEQVt2pZ5V81XwKTFjaMyK81
transaction
81868f2240a4137d6ca022bda03f1107119a48655fb75c59c68756b087aa0a44
spent
true